Output d05372dc316c98aed2791091e7ca7a6aa095ae2104a91d1e8d18cd55e93e95da:3

value
1252338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53016573adbb72612274ea4387748e6b40898945 OP_EQUAL
address
39FugUusar5Vs817r7zBs5iHAmfYTyqHfM
transaction
d05372dc316c98aed2791091e7ca7a6aa095ae2104a91d1e8d18cd55e93e95da
spent
true